资源简介
关于MFC连接ACCESS数据库,并对数据库的基本操作
代码片段和文件信息
// addxinxi.cpp : implementation file
//
#include “stdafx.h“
#include “caozuo.h“
#include “addxinxi.h“
#include “caozuoDlg.h“
#include “Adosql.h“
#ifdef _DEBUG
#define new DEBUG_NEW
#undef THIS_FILE
static char THIS_FILE[] = __FILE__;
#endif
Adosql sql;
/////////////////////////////////////////////////////////////////////////////
// addxinxi dialog
addxinxi::addxinxi(CWnd* pParent /*=NULL*/)
: CDialog(addxinxi::IDD pParent)
{
//{{AFX_DATA_INIT(addxinxi)
//}}AFX_DATA_INIT
}
void addxinxi::DoDataExchange(CDataExchange* pDX)
{
CDialog::DoDataExchange(pDX);
//{{AFX_DATA_MAP(addxinxi)
DDX_Control(pDX IDC_EDIT9_fax m_fax);
DDX_Control(pDX IDC_EDIT8_mp m_mp);
DDX_Control(pDX IDC_EDIT7_gh m_gh);
DDX_Control(pDX IDC_EDIT6_gongzi m_gongzi);
DDX_Control(pDX IDC_EDIT5_job m_job);
DDX_Control(pDX IDC_EDIT4_nianling m_nianling);
DDX_Control(pDX IDC_EDIT3_xingbie m_xingbie);
DDX_Control(pDX IDC_EDIT2_xingming m_xingming);
DDX_Control(pDX IDC_EDIT11_dizhi m_dizhi);
DDX_Control(pDX IDC_EDIT10_EQQ m_EQQ);
DDX_Control(pDX IDC_EDIT1_bianhao m_bianhao);
//}}AFX_DATA_MAP
}
BEGIN_MESSAGE_MAP(addxinxi CDialog)
//{{AFX_MSG_MAP(addxinxi)
//}}AFX_MSG_MAP
END_MESSAGE_MAP()
/////////////////////////////////////////////////////////////////////////////
// addxinxi message handlers
void addxinxi::OnOK()
{
// TODO: Add extra validation here
try
{
_variant_t RecordsAffected;
CString sno;
CString sname;
CString sex;
CString sage;
CString sjob;
CString sgz;
CString sgh;
CString smp;
CString sfa;
CString seq;
CString sad;
_bstr_t Insert;
m_bianhao.GetWindowText(sno);
m_xingming.GetWindowText(sname);
m_nianling.GetWindowText(sage);
m_xingbie.GetWindowText(sex);
m_job.GetWindowText(sjob);
m_gongzi.GetWindowText(sgz);
m_gh.GetWindowText(sgh);
m_mp.GetWindowText(smp);
m_fax.GetWindowText(sfa);
m_EQQ.GetWindowText(seq);
m_dizhi.GetWindowText(sad);//(编号姓名 *性别年龄工作岗位工资(月)固定电话移动电话 *传真Email/QQ居住地址)
Insert = “Insert into userlist values(‘“+sno+“‘‘“+sname+“‘‘“+sex+“‘‘“+sage+“‘‘“+sjob+“‘\
‘“+sgz+ “‘‘“+sgh+“‘ ‘“+smp+“‘ ‘“+sfa+ “‘‘“+seq+“‘‘“+sad+“‘)“;
psql->m_pRecordset = psql->m_pConnection->Execute(Insert &RecordsAffected adCmdText);
AfxMessageBox(“添加成功!“);
//清空输入框
m_bianhao.SetSel(0-1);
m_bianhao.Clear();
m_xingming.SetSel(0-1);
m_xingming.Clear();
m_nianling.SetSel(0-1);
m_nianling.Clear();
m_xingbie.SetSel(0-1);
m_xingbie.Clear();
m_job.SetSel(0-1);
m_job.Clear();
m_gongzi.SetSel(0-1);
m_gongzi.Clear();
m_gh.SetSel(0-1);
m_gh.Clear();
m_mp.SetSel(0-1);
m_mp.Clear();
m_fax.SetSel(0-1);
m_fax.Clear();
m_EQQ.SetSel(0-1);
m_EQQ.Clear();
m_dizhi.SetSel(0-1);
m_dizhi.Clear();
}
catch (_com_error e)
{
CString errormessage;
errormessage.Format(“添加失败!\r\n错误信息:%s“ e.ErrorMessage()
属性 大小 日期 时间 名称
----------- --------- ---------- ----- ----
目录 0 2012-11-08 17:34 查找、增加、删除 修改\
目录 0 2012-11-21 17:24 查找、增加、删除 修改\caozuo\
文件 3121 2012-09-24 22:28 查找、增加、删除 修改\caozuo\addxinxi.cpp
文件 1365 2012-09-23 22:15 查找、增加、删除 修改\caozuo\addxinxi.h
文件 1096 2012-09-26 10:22 查找、增加、删除 修改\caozuo\Adosql.cpp
文件 654 2012-09-21 22:52 查找、增加、删除 修改\caozuo\Adosql.h
文件 26000 2012-11-21 17:24 查找、增加、删除 修改\caozuo\caozuo.aps
文件 4694 2012-11-21 17:24 查找、增加、删除 修改\caozuo\caozuo.clw
文件 2096 2012-09-22 19:57 查找、增加、删除 修改\caozuo\caozuo.cpp
文件 4656 2012-09-24 11:55 查找、增加、删除 修改\caozuo\caozuo.dsp
文件 520 2012-09-21 18:07 查找、增加、删除 修改\caozuo\caozuo.dsw
文件 1393 2012-09-21 20:25 查找、增加、删除 修改\caozuo\caozuo.h
文件 345088 2012-11-21 17:24 查找、增加、删除 修改\caozuo\caozuo.ncb
文件 54784 2012-11-21 17:24 查找、增加、删除 修改\caozuo\caozuo.opt
文件 1288 2012-11-21 17:24 查找、增加、删除 修改\caozuo\caozuo.plg
文件 10433 2012-09-25 00:34 查找、增加、删除 修改\caozuo\caozuo.rc
文件 8059 2012-09-26 10:23 查找、增加、删除 修改\caozuo\caozuoDlg.cpp
文件 1468 2012-09-24 11:49 查找、增加、删除 修改\caozuo\caozuoDlg.h
目录 0 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\
文件 58435 2012-09-24 22:28 查找、增加、删除 修改\caozuo\Debug\addxinxi.obj
文件 40793 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\Adosql.obj
文件 155746 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\caozuo.exe
文件 1049320 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\caozuo.ilk
文件 16590 2012-09-23 00:05 查找、增加、删除 修改\caozuo\Debug\caozuo.obj
文件 7769344 2012-09-21 22:52 查找、增加、删除 修改\caozuo\Debug\caozuo.pch
文件 648192 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\caozuo.pdb
文件 4960 2012-09-26 10:17 查找、增加、删除 修改\caozuo\Debug\caozuo.res
文件 96648 2012-11-21 17:24 查找、增加、删除 修改\caozuo\Debug\caozuoDlg.obj
文件 76486 2012-09-25 00:12 查找、增加、删除 修改\caozuo\Debug\Delete.obj
文件 90772 2012-06-06 13:09 查找、增加、删除 修改\caozuo\Debug\msado15.tlh
文件 76693 2012-06-06 13:09 查找、增加、删除 修改\caozuo\Debug\msado15.tli
............此处省略18个文件信息
- 上一篇:数据结构——C++语言描述 陈慧南
- 下一篇:C++ Doodle Jump源码
相关资源
- vc.6.0 MFC 人事管理系统源码
- MFC 在线考试系统
- MFC基于对话框游戏 打字游戏1.0V
- 自绘CListCtrl聊天列表MFC
- MFC与坦克大战代码
- VC++酒店客房管理系统 MFC
- MFC实训_超市管理系统
- MFC游戏——看看你能坚持几秒
- VC++编程的第一个MFC工程Hello World
- 面向对象编程MFC综合实验代码
- VS2013 / MFC + OpenCV 2.4.9实现视频的播放
- MFC 精仿QQ主界面无闪烁移动,抽屉
- MFC实现的红绿灯程序
- MFC编程凯撒密码
- MFC制作的飞机大战游戏
- MFC课程设计学生管理系统
- vs2013登录界面mfc
- MFC平台C++语言的小游戏代码
- 基于MFC的图像的拼接系统
- ffmpeg for MFC 1.2 源代码
- windows下的ffmpeg、MFC制作的播放器
- 基于VC++利用MFC做的图书管理系统
- MFC智能停车场管理系统
- VC++用MFC做选课系统
- MFC VC++实现Sierpinski分形图像
- MFC基于对话框的气体浓度检测系统
- 功能强大的多条曲线绘制类 (MFC,
- MFC_带进度条的状态栏
- 用C++写的FTP客户端
- c++编写的十字路口交通灯程序
评论
共有 条评论